HYDERABAD: Are you an worker struggling to make time for train? A couple of minutes of brisk strolling a number of instances throughout workplace hours, climbing stairs or repeatedly getting up from the desk and transferring round might nonetheless assist decrease the chance of creating sort 2 diabetes, a brand new research printed in Diabetes Care suggests.
The research in contrast individuals who did no leisure-time train and remained largely inactive with those that amassed quick bursts of bodily exercise in the course of the day. It shouldn’t be interpreted as suggesting that office-hour brisk walks are higher than an everyday morning stroll or a structured train routine. For many who can mix common train with motion breaks in the course of the working day, the extra exercise is more likely to be extra useful.
The research, titled Dose–Response Associations of Intermittent Life-style Bodily Exercise Micropatterns and Incident Sort 2 Diabetes, analysed 22,706 UK Biobank contributors who reported no leisure-time train and didn’t have diabetes in the beginning of the research. Contributors had been monitored utilizing wrist-worn accelerometers and adopted for a mean of seven.9 years, throughout which 665 developed sort 2 diabetes.
Researchers discovered that 3.9 minutes a day of vigorous intermittent life-style bodily exercise (VILPA) was related to a 36 per cent decrease threat of creating sort 2 diabetes in contrast with no such exercise. About 25.3 minutes a day of moderate-to-vigorous intermittent life-style bodily exercise was related to a 46 per cent decrease threat.
Hyderabad neurologist Dr Sudhir Kumar stated the findings had been notably related to individuals who couldn’t spare an hour for train within the morning however might incorporate quick bouts of exercise throughout working hours.
“This research is helpful for individuals who don’t get time for an hour of train within the morning. As an alternative of sitting constantly throughout workplace hours, they will take these quick bouts of exercise. When you are able to do each, a morning one-hour stroll or train and staying lively throughout workplace hours, that’s an extra benefit and could be extra useful,” he stated.
In keeping with Dr Kumar, the research’s second group — individuals who do not need time for morning train however can undertake quick, unstructured bouts of exercise in the course of the day — may profit. “The worst impact is on those that don’t do something. If somebody can’t handle an everyday morning train routine, these train snacks in the course of the day are nonetheless significant,” he stated.
The exercise needn’t contain a proper exercise. Strolling briskly between totally different sections of an workplace, climbing one or two flights of stairs a number of instances a day or getting up from the desk and transferring round can contribute to bodily exercise. Dr Kumar stated folks might take a two- to three-minute motion break each 40 to 45 minutes to keep away from extended sitting.
“Most tips discuss 150 minutes of moderate-to-vigorous exercise every week. For many individuals, that appears overwhelming. This research reveals that shorter bouts of train may make a distinction by way of diabetes threat,” he stated.
Dr Kumar additionally burdened that train shouldn’t be considered as an alternative choice to a wholesome life-style or common bodily exercise amongst those that can handle it. He stated folks with a genetic predisposition to diabetes needs to be notably cautious in regards to the modifiable elements, together with weight loss plan, bodily exercise and satisfactory relaxation.
“The genetic element can’t be modified, however no matter is modifiable is in our fingers. That’s the place train performs a task,” he stated.
He added that train doesn’t eradicate the chance of diabetes however can cut back the chance of creating the illness. Subsequently, individuals who have the time and talent to undertake an everyday one-hour train routine ought to proceed doing so, whereas additionally avoiding extended intervals of sitting.
